Cake-PHP

Inter-company training

Duration

 3,00 day(s)

Language(s) of service

EN FR

Who is organizing this training?

Dawan is a training organisation that offers more than 2000 training courses in IT, management, project management and sales in instructor-led live online or on-site trainings. We have 11 centres in France and we have developed partnerships with local structures in Brussels, Luxembourg and Geneva. Our catalogue includes hundreds of topics: Java, PHP, Webmaster, E-Marketing, Linux, Windows Server, Vmware, Autocad, Photoshop, IA etc. Our courses have been created and designed by in-house trainers who have over 20 years of teaching experience. Constantly renewed, they are adapted to the requirements of our customers and to the evolution of technologies.

Who is the training for?

Développeurs PHP expérimentés

Prerequisites

Maîtrise de PHP de la syntaxe à  la programmation orientée objet

Goals

Connaître les possibilités et alternatives au framework Cake-PHP - Être capable de préparer, mettre en oeuvre et maintenir une application utilisant Cake-PHP.

Contents

Framework Cake-PHP

Notions de framework
Introduction à Cake-PHP
Intérêt de Cake-PHP
Alternatives

Installer et configurer Cake-PHP

Installation, organisation générale
Configuration
Ecriture d´URLs

Atelier pratique: Mettre en place une application web Cake-PHP

Comprendre les contrôleurs et composants

Présentation du contrôleur
Gestion de la session
Redirections
Les composants

Atelier pratique: Récupération des paramètres d´un formulaire -Diverses interactions modèle-vues

Comprendre les vues et assistants

Présentation de la vue
Les formulaires
Les assistants

Atelier pratique: Mise en place d'interfaces efficaces

Comprendre les modèles et les comportements

Configuration de l´accès à la base de données
Relations entre tables et objets métier
Les comportements

Atelier pratique: Stockage de données d´un formulaire

Concevoir une application Cake-PHP

Présentation du modèle MVC Cake-PHP
Préparer l´application Web
Validation des données
Gestion des erreurs
Redirections
Débogage

Atelier pratique: Gestion d´une application web Cake-PHP

Teaching methods

Méthodologie basée sur l'Active Learning : 75% de pratique minimum. Chaque point théorique est systématiquement suivi d'exemples et exercices.

Evaluation

Contrôle continu

Certificate, diploma

Attestation de fin de stage mentionnant le résultat des acquis

Course material

Support de cours + sources des scripts

These courses might interest you

EN
Day
Software - Graphic software - Cad/cam software - SolidWorks Software